Sat 1310648798991893

decimal
314259.1298991893
degree
0°104259′1779″1298991893‴
percentile
62.41184763969558%
name
eoixcbpvrxs
cycle
0
epoch
1
period
155
block
314259
offset
1298991893
timestamp
rarity
common
inscriptions
location
89e7552c9bae83a822ffeed1bfcd7d0b94c8afb98042fd0e312d790a3df64891:1:10289
address
bc1p8rm2xc59j4d4js6gqkgl0rujduj0fttwp7lf9amnhyv2ca7ql3rq2905mt